You can view the current display path in Settings > System > Display > Advanced display. Windows shows the selected screen's desktop mode, active signal mode, refresh-rate information, bit depth, color format, and color space. This is a read-only check as long as you do not use the refresh-rate, HDR, color-management, or adapter-mode controls on the page.
I reproduced the procedure on Windows 11 Home Single Language, version 25H2, build 26220.7872. The tested internal display reported 1920 × 1080 at 144 Hz for both desktop and active signal modes, variable refresh support from the driver, 8-bit depth, RGB format, and standard dynamic range. Your values can differ because Windows reports the active display path, not a universal specification for every screen.
What should you know before checking display information?
Advanced display is useful when you need to document what Windows is currently sending to one screen. It does not necessarily show every mode a monitor advertises or the panel's full marketing specification. A dock, cable, adapter, graphics driver, projection mode, HDR state, power mode, or different port can change what appears.
On a multi-monitor PC, select the intended display before reading the values. Windows can report a different resolution, refresh rate, bit depth, color format, color space, variable-refresh status, or HDR certification for each screen. Do not assume the first item in the selector is the external monitor you want.

How do you view display information in Windows 11?
- Press Windows + I to open Settings.
- Select System, select Display, then select Advanced display.
- If more than one display is connected, use Select a display to view or change its settings to choose the correct screen. Do not change the topology or display mode.
- Expand Display information when necessary, then read the available rows. Do not select Choose a refresh rate or any other setting merely to inspect the page.
- Close Settings after recording the values. The procedure changes no setting, so there is nothing to roll back.

Microsoft's refresh-rate guidance confirms this Advanced display path and explains that Display information shows the current resolution, refresh rate, and variable-refresh support for the selected screen. The other rows shown by Windows are still hardware- and driver-dependent.
What do Desktop mode and Active signal mode mean?
Desktop mode describes the Windows desktop image being rendered for that display path. Active signal mode describes the active target signal sent through the output path. This interpretation follows Microsoft's documented source-and-target display architecture. It is safer than calling either row the monitor's native specification.
The two modes can match, as they did on the tested laptop, but a difference is not automatically a fault. Scaling or signal processing can cause Windows to render one desktop size while the graphics path sends another signal. Use the numbers as a configuration clue; do not change modes simply to make the rows look identical.
How should you interpret refresh rate and variable refresh rate?
A refresh rate is how many times the screen updates each second. Microsoft notes that available rates depend on the display, and Windows can mark a rate that would also change the current resolution. This guide does not select a rate because doing so would turn a read-only inspection into a display change.
Variable refresh rate: Supported by driver reports support for the current path. It does not prove that a game or app is actively varying the rate at that moment. Likewise, the number beside a mode is a configuration value, not a real-time measurement of every instantaneous update under VRR or Dynamic Refresh Rate.
What does bit depth tell you?
Bit depth is numerical color precision. Microsoft explains that higher precision can distinguish closer color values and reduce visible banding. The row commonly reports 8-bit or 10-bit for the current display path, but the value alone does not prove HDR quality, the panel's native depth, whether frame-rate control is used, or the precision inside an individual application.
Do not confuse this row with CurrentBitsPerPixel from the Win32_VideoController class. That adapter-level property can report total bits per pixel, such as 32, and it is not the same measurement as the 8-bit or 10-bit color-channel presentation in Advanced display.
What do Color format and Color space mean?
Color format identifies the current output encoding family, such as RGB or a YCbCr format. RGB does not, by itself, tell you whether the signal uses full or limited range, and YCbCr does not by itself prove HDR. The row also does not certify color accuracy.
Color space describes the current Windows display state, commonly Standard dynamic range (SDR) or High dynamic range (HDR). Do not translate SDR into an exact sRGB coverage percentage or HDR into guaranteed BT.2020 coverage. Accurate gamut, luminance, and calibration claims require more specific display data and measurement.
Why might HDR certification, nits, or peak brightness be missing?
Advanced display shows only fields that Windows, the graphics stack, and the display expose for the selected path. An SDR screen can omit HDR certification, luminance, nits, and peak-brightness rows completely. That is what happened on the tested internal display, so this guide does not invent values or show an HDR example from another machine.
Microsoft says that HDR certification: Not found can mean that the display is not certified or that the manufacturer has not published certification information. It is not the same as an HDR-capability result. For capability, use the separate Settings > System > Display > HDR page and select the same screen. Do not toggle HDR just to view its capability labels.
What changes when you use multiple displays?
Windows numbers detected displays, and the selected screen matters. If you are unsure which physical monitor is Display 1 or Display 2, return to the main Display page and use Identify. This briefly shows a number on each screen without changing the display arrangement.
Duplicate mode can constrain what Windows reports because both screens must operate together. Microsoft specifically documents cases where a duplicated laptop and external display can report HDR as unsupported. Recheck the exact selected screen and current projection mode before concluding that a monitor lacks a feature.
What can you do if display information is incomplete?
First, confirm that the intended display is selected and active. A disconnected or inactive path cannot supply complete current-mode information. Next, reconnect the approved cable or dock only if normal troubleshooting already requires it; this article does not ask you to change connections simply to produce different numbers.
If values appear stale after a normal driver or Windows update, close and reopen Settings and restart Windows at a convenient time. Avoid Registry edits, custom-resolution tools, driver removal, or GPU-control-panel changes as information-gathering steps. Those actions change state and do not belong in a read-only lookup.
An optional PowerShell adapter query can report current resolution and refresh-rate properties, but it does not replace Advanced display. Hybrid graphics systems can list more than one adapter, properties can be blank, and the command cannot reproduce color format, color space, HDR certification, or per-monitor source-versus-target rows. The Settings route remains the clearest method for this intent.
What should you remove before sharing a screenshot?
A full Settings frame can expose the signed-in profile, email address, monitor or GPU model, display numbering, notifications, and taskbar content. Crop the image to the information block and share only the fields needed to diagnose the question. Never include unrelated account details or a raw DirectX diagnostic export.
Display and GPU model names are hardware inventory. They can be relevant to support, but disclose them only when the reader or technician needs them. The public image in this guide excludes the account area and unrelated controls while keeping the locally reproduced fields legible.
Frequently Asked Questions
Does 10-bit color mean HDR is enabled?
No. Bit depth is one part of the display path. Use the separate HDR page for the selected screen to check capability and current HDR state.
Why do Desktop mode and Active signal mode differ?
Windows can render one desktop size while scaling or sending a different target signal. A mismatch is a clue about the path, not automatic proof of a problem.
Does Supported by driver mean VRR is active?
No. It reports support for the current path. Whether an app is actively using variable refresh depends on the hardware, driver, application, and related settings.
Why is HDR certification not shown?
The selected display path may not expose certification metadata. Even “Not found” is inconclusive; check Display capabilities on the separate HDR page.
Read the current path without changing it
Use Advanced display to document the selected screen's current desktop and signal modes, refresh information, bit depth, color format, and color space. Interpret each row narrowly, expect hardware-dependent fields to be absent, and use the separate HDR page for capability rather than guessing from certification or bit depth.
